Key Material Types
Choosing the right material for a food-grade water storage tank is essential for ensuring safety and quality. I always look for BPA-free materials to prevent chemical leaching, which keeps the water safe for consumption. It’s vital that the tanks are made from food-grade certified materials, meeting strict health standards. High-density polyethylene (HDPE) is often my go-to choice due to its durability and impact resistance. Additionally, I prefer tanks with UV-resistant properties to protect against harmful rays that can spoil the water and encourage algae growth. Finally, I appreciate tanks made from recyclable content, as they support environmental sustainability while maintaining the necessary safety for food storage. These factors guide my selection process effectively.
Capacity Requirements
Understanding your capacity requirements is vital for selecting the right food-grade water storage tank. I always assess my daily water consumption needs first, typically measured in liters or gallons. If you have a larger household, tanks of 30 liters (7.9 gallons) or more might be necessary. Don’t forget to factor in potential emergencies; having a tank between 50 to 200 liters (13.2 to 52.8 gallons) guarantees long-term preparedness. Depending on your intended use—like brewing or camping—you might need specific capacities for convenience. Finally, consider the physical space available; larger tanks require more room, so balance your capacity needs with your storage area’s limitations. This way, you can choose a tank that truly fits your lifestyle.

How Do I Clean a Food Grade Water Storage Tank?
To clean a food grade water storage tank, I first drain all the water. Then, I scrub the interior with a mixture of warm water and mild soap, using a brush to reach all areas. After rinsing thoroughly, I fill it with a solution of water and vinegar to disinfect, letting it sit for at least 30 minutes. Finally, I rinse it once more to guarantee there’s no residue left before refilling it with water.

What Is the Lifespan of Food Grade Water Tanks?
The lifespan of food grade water tanks typically ranges from 10 to 30 years, depending on materials and maintenance. I’ve found that high-quality polyethylene tanks last longer and resist UV damage and corrosion. To maximize their life, I always keep them clean and store them in a shaded area. Regular inspections help me catch any issues early, ensuring my water stays safe and the tank remains functional for years.
Are These Tanks UV Resistant?
Yes, many food-grade water storage tanks are UV resistant. I always check the specifications before purchasing to confirm they can withstand sunlight exposure. UV resistance helps prevent algae growth and keeps the water safe for drinking. I’ve found that tanks made from high-density polyethylene (HDPE) often offer this feature. If you’re considering a tank, make sure it’s designed to handle UV light; it can make a big difference in maintaining water quality.
How Should I Store the Tanks When Not in Use?
“Out of sight, out of mind” rings true here. When I store my tanks, I clean them thoroughly and let them dry completely to prevent mold. I keep them in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ight. If possible, I stack them to save space, but I make sure they’re stable to avoid tipping over. Covering them with a breathable cloth can help keep dust away while allowing air circulation.
